Elizabeth G. "Gert" (Fox) Curran, a lifelong resident of Charlestown, passed away into eternal life on Friday, March 2, 2012 at Glen Ridge Nursing Care Center in Medford after a brief illness. She was 102 years old.
Gert was born in Boston on September 22, 1909 to the late John J. and Kate (Boyle) Fox. She grew up in Charlestown and attended the Boston Public School system. Gert was a homemaker and dedicated her life to her children following the death of her husband who passed away 75 years ago.
Gert is the beloved wife of the late Lawrence R. Curran. She is the devoted mother of Lawrence R. Curran Jr. of Charlestown, Catherine M. West of Malden, Joan G. Matarazzo of Medford, Marilyn E. Mullaney of Malden, Theresa C. Roche of Townsend and the late Catherine Hickey, Patricia Sullivan and Gertrude Toner. She is the loving Nana to 26 grandchildren, 61 great-grandchildren and 12 great-great-grandchildren.
